Yang Shi is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Molecular Biology and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Yang Shi has authored 34 papers receiving a total of 999 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 6 papers in Molecular Biology and 4 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. Recurrent topics in Yang Shi's work include Advanced Battery Materials and Technologies (3 papers), Epigenetics and DNA Methylation (3 papers) and Advancements in Battery Materials (3 papers). Yang Shi is often cited by papers focused on Advanced Battery Materials and Technologies (3 papers), Epigenetics and DNA Methylation (3 papers) and Advancements in Battery Materials (3 papers). Yang Shi coll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Japan. Yang Shi's co-authors include Robert J. Schwartz, Ulla Hansen, David M. Margolis, James Davie, Katherine Galvin, Jason J. Coull, Fabio Romerio, J Völker, Feizhen Wu and Ruitu Lv and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Nucleic Acids Research and Angewandte Chemie International Edition.
